How Common Is The Last Name Muelleman? popularity and diffusion

The surname is the 3,100,440th most widespread surname on a global scale, held by approximately 1 in 182,188,648 people. This surname occ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 98 percent of Muelleman are found; 98 percent are found in North America and 98 percent are found in Anglo-North America.

It is most commonly held in The United States, where it is carried by 39 people, or 1 in 9,293,819. In The United States it is primarily concentrated in: Missouri, where 49 percent reside, Nebraska, where 18 percent reside and California, where 13 percent reside. Barring The United States Muelleman occurs in one country. It is also found in Afghanistan, where 3 percent reside.

Muelleman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The incidence of Muelleman has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the last name increased 3,900 percent between 1880 and 2014.
